GUACAMOLE-1128: Add MySQL and PostgreSQL auto creation for Docker
diff --git a/guacamole-docker/bin/start.sh b/guacamole-docker/bin/start.sh
index 0ac0357..3d3244e 100755
--- a/guacamole-docker/bin/start.sh
+++ b/guacamole-docker/bin/start.sh
@@ -231,6 +231,10 @@
set_property "mysql-ssl-client-password" "$MYSQL_SSL_CLIENT_PASSWORD"
fi
+ set_optional_property \
+ "mysql-auto-create-accounts" \
+ "$MYSQL_AUTO_CREATE_ACCOUNTS"
+
# Add required .jar files to GUACAMOLE_LIB and GUACAMOLE_EXT
ln -s /opt/guacamole/mysql/mysql-connector-*.jar "$GUACAMOLE_LIB"
ln -s /opt/guacamole/mysql/guacamole-auth-*.jar "$GUACAMOLE_EXT"
@@ -389,6 +393,10 @@
set_property "postgresql-ssl-key-password" "$POSTGRES_SSL_KEY_PASSWORD"
fi
+ set_optional_property \
+ "postgresql-auto-create-accounts" \
+ "$POSTGRESQL_AUTO_CREATE_ACCOUNTS"
+
# Add required .jar files to GUACAMOLE_LIB and GUACAMOLE_EXT
ln -s /opt/guacamole/postgresql/postgresql-*.jar "$GUACAMOLE_LIB"
ln -s /opt/guacamole/postgresql/guacamole-auth-*.jar "$GUACAMOLE_EXT"